Würk, the leading provider of HR, payroll, and workforce management technology within the cannabis industry, today announced a strategic partnership with Symphony Grow, the specialty cannabis business of Symphony Risk Solutions.
The partnership brings together Würk's robust HR, payroll, and workforce compliance technology with Symphony Grow's expertise in insurance, employee benefits, and risk management, creating a unified offering that supports cannabis businesses day-to-day operations and long-term growth.
"Cannabis operators are under increasing pressure to remain compliant while protecting their people and their businesses," said Deborah Saneman, CEO at Würk. "Through this partnership with Symphony Grow, we're expanding the scope of what it means to support a compliant, people-first cannabis organization from payroll to protection."

Würk and Symphony Grow were purpose-built to serve the cannabis sector, offering tailored coverage and strategic counsel across key operational functions. Their combined team of experienced advisors provides support in navigating the complex insurance landscape and designing benefit programs that support workforce retention and compliance.
"This partnership reflects the very best of what Symphony Grow was built to do – deliver specialty expertise that meets the cannabis industry where it operates," said T.J. Frost, President of Symphony Grow. "Würk has set the standard for HR and compliance. Together, we are helping operators navigate risk and create a strategic advantage. Combining our disciplines give our clients unique solutions not available from traditional advisors."
The referral-based partnership allows clients from either company to seamlessly access integrated services and support, streamlining vendor management and enabling stronger operational outcomes.
